Senior Finance Business Partner in Finance team supporting strategic decision-making and performance analysis across business units in an international IT organization.
Responsibilities
Lead budgeting, forecasting, and reporting activities across profit/cost centers on a regular basis.
Analyze financial performance, identify deviations, and provide actionable insights and commentary to stakeholders.
Develop and maintain financial, statistical, and analytical models, presenting findings and recommendations to management and business partners.
Conduct ad-hoc financial analyses, including scenario (what-if) modeling and market risk assessments.
Act as a trusted financial advisor to business leaders, offering strategic guidance and decision support.
Ensure accuracy and integrity of financial data within internal systems, continuously optimizing processes for efficiency and reliability.
Requirements
Master's degree in Finance, Economics, Banking, or a related discipline.
Minimum 5 years of experience in Finance, Controlling, or a similar analytical function—preferably within an international IT organization.
Proven ability to synthesize complex data into meaningful insights and communicate them effectively.
Advanced proficiency in MS Office, particularly Excel (pivot tables, advanced formulas, data modeling) and PowerPoint.
Excellent attention to detail, with str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
Strong communication and interpersonal skills, capable of building productive partnerships across departments.
English: B2 (Upper-Intermediate) or higher proficiency required.
